Food Grade Industrial Gases – Top Global Industry Trends in 2026
The global Food Grade Industrial Gases Market, valued at USD 8.5 billion in 2025, is projected to reach USD 12.6 billion by 2035, expanding at a 4.0% CAGR. Growth is supported by strong demand for extended shelf-life solutions, stringent food safety regulations, and increasing consumption of packaged, frozen, and convenience foods across major economies.

Rising Need for Freshness, Shelf Stability, and High-Purity Gases Drives Market Growth
Consumer preference for high-quality, minimally processed, and hygienically packaged foods is accelerating the adoption of industrial gases across the supply chain. These gases are essential to extending shelf life, preventing microbial spoilage, and retaining flavor and texture during storage and transport.
Rapid growth in the global cold chain, rising cross-border trade in packaged foods, and stricter regulatory standards are further strengthening demand. Technologies such as modified atmosphere packaging (MAP) and advanced cryogenic freezing rely heavily on nitrogen, carbon dioxide, and oxygen—solidifying their place as critical enablers of food safety and quality.
Segmental Highlights
Nitrogen Leads with 41.3% Market Share in 2025
Nitrogen remains the most widely used food-grade gas due to its inert properties and its vital role in:
- Modified atmosphere packaging
- Chilling and freezing
- Blanketing and pressurization processes
Its effectiveness in maintaining freshness, preventing oxidation, and extending shelf life has made it indispensable, particularly for dairy, meat, bakery, and packaged food exporters. Advancements in gas purity and distribution technologies are further reinforcing nitrogen’s dominance.
Beverages Remain Top End-Use Sector with 27.9% Share
Food-grade gases are fundamental to beverage production, especially for:
- Carbonation of soft drinks, sparkling water, and beer
- Creating smooth textures and extended shelf life in specialty beverages
- Maintaining product safety across long distribution cycles
Rising global consumption of RTD beverages, premium drinks, and functional beverages continues to push demand for CO₂ and nitrogen.
Market Overview: Convenience Food Momentum Accelerates Growth
The market’s 4% CAGR outlook from 2025–2035 is supported by surging demand for frozen and ready-to-cook foods. Urbanization, workforce expansion, and pandemic-driven lifestyle shifts have intensified reliance on foods with longer shelf life and greater convenience.
The hospitality sector’s expansion and a global rise in carbonated beverage consumption are also key contributors. Manufacturers continue to leverage industrial gases for safer packaging, better product stability, and improved operational efficiency.
Innovation in Packaging and Freezing Technologies Unlocks New Opportunities
As consumers increasingly demand fresh, preservative-free food options, manufacturers are adopting:
- Modified atmosphere packaging (MAP)
- Cryogenic freezing
- Controlled atmosphere storage
These innovations reduce chemical preservatives and ensure food quality across seasons and geographies. The year-round consumption of exotic fruits and premium foods has further fueled demand for high-purity gases.

Regional Outlook: Asia Pacific Emerges as the Fastest-Growing Market
While North America and Europe maintain strong consumption due to mature food processing industries, Asia Pacific leads in growth due to:
- Higher consumption of packaged and convenience foods
- Expanding cold chain infrastructure
- Rapid urbanization in India and China
- Growing working population with evolving dietary preferences
Country-level CAGRs highlight this momentum, with China (5.4%) and India (5.0%) outperforming global growth rates.
